The best in the series I've read all of Bobby Marks adventures and this is his hour of humanity. Bobby's 18 now and finds work at the local laundry service where he thinks his summer will be full of girl's and bar fights. He's hired by Sinclair, the new owner who he believes to be a great guy. Joanie returns from Europe as her family has gotten richer from invetments. Bobby goes to a party at her house and sees Sinclair with a woman who's not his wife. Bobby's summer gets harder when his father begins to grow sicker after an operation. As he's dealing with this, Joanie has him lie for her as to where she is to her parents. As Bobby goes on route with one of the other workers, he sees Sinclair with a girl and kiss her. As the girl turns, Bobby sees that it's Joanie. A week later, Joanie tells him she's pregnant. A day before, Bobby learned that his father is getting worse and the workers of the laundry keep getting hurt by faulty equiptment. Now Bobby has to decide what to do to save his friend and how to lead the local workers.
This book delt with darker elements then the previous two such as adultry and abortion in the 50's but Bobby rises to all the challenges thrown his way showing he has matured from "The Crisco Kid" to "The Summerboy."
